I had a 328 until recently and had it serviced by a highly competent mechanic named Chris Gemini. He has suspended his business while he works on his homestead, and I don't know how amenable he'd be to taking on new work. He's at cgacustom.com and lives near Volcano. On the Kona side there are a couple of possibilities: European Auto Specialist of Hawaii owned by Mike Getzinger, whose shop is in Kealakekua. He specializes in Porsches, but I have seen a couple 308s in his shop being worked on. He's at [email protected]. The other is another independent who once was a tech for a big-name Ferrari dealership in California. I believe he is at the Auto Clinic of Kona, 808-329-3787. That should get you started.
